Comprehending UPVC and Its Advantages in Door Construction


UPVC stands apart from regular PVC through its stiff structure, achieved by leaving out the plasticisers that offer other PVC items their flexibility. This unplasticised formulation results in a product that shows extraordinary resistance to weathering, chemical deterioration, and physical stress. Unlike wooden doors that require routine painting and sealing to prevent rot and degeneration, UPVC doors maintain their structural integrity and look with minimal maintenance requirements.

The thermal efficiency of UPVC contributes significantly to its popularity in climates with extreme temperature level variations. The material's low thermal conductivity suggests that it does not transfer heat or cold easily, helping to keep comfy indoor temperature levels despite external conditions. When combined with suitable glass setups, UPVC doors achieve impressive energy scores that can significantly lower heating & cooling expenses throughout the year.

Glass Options for UPVC Doors


Picking the suitable glass for your UPVC door setup includes examining a number of unique choices, each offering distinct benefits suited to different concerns and spending plans.

Double glazing represents the most common choice for UPVC door setups, including 2 panes of glass separated by a vacuum or gas-filled spacer. This building develops an insulating barrier that considerably lowers heat transfer and noise penetration. The energy savings offered by double glazing generally offset the greater preliminary financial investment within a few years, making this option economically sensible for a lot of property owners.

Triple glazing supplies even higher thermal and acoustic efficiency through using three glass panes. While more costly than double glazing, triple-glazed units provide exceptional insulation homes that prove particularly valuable in chillier areas or for homeowners seeking the highest possible energy efficiency rankings. The added weight of triple-glazed units may require reinforcement of door frames, a consideration that affects installation intricacy and expense.

Toughened glass, also understood as tempered glass, goes through specialised heat treatment that increases its strength fivefold compared to standard glass of the exact same density. When toughened glass does break, it shatters into small, fairly safe granules rather than sharp fragments, making it an important security function for door installations. Building policies often mandate making use of toughened or laminated glass in door installations, particularly in ground-floor applications.

Laminated glass includes 2 or more glass layers bonded together with a transparent interlayer, normally made of polyvinyl butyral (PVB). This construction holds the glass together if shattered, providing enhanced security and sound insulation. Laminated glass also provides UV security, blocking up to 99% of harmful ultraviolet rays that can fade furniture and floor covering.

The Professional Installation Process


Comprehending the installation process assists homeowners value the intricacy involved and recognise quality workmanship. Expert installers usually follow a methodical technique that guarantees optimal efficiency and longevity.

The process begins with precise measurement of the existing door frame or the prepared opening, accounting for clearance tolerances and thinking about the particular requirements of the chosen glass system. upvc door installation examine the condition of existing UPVC frames, examining for damage, warping, or wear and tear that may compromise the setup's efficiency or require remediation before proceeding.

Removal of existing glass panels requires careful managing to avoid damage to surrounding frame parts. Experts use specialised tools to release glazing beads and carefully extract old systems, paying specific attention to any decorative aspects that will require reinstallation. The exposed frame surfaces receive extensive cleaning to guarantee ideal adhesion of brand-new sealing materials.

New glass units are positioned with accurate alignment, utilizing Packers to achieve best positioning within the frame. Installers apply suitable glazing tape and sealants to develop weatherproof joints that avoid water seepage and air leak. Finally, glazing beads are clipped into location, securing the glass while allowing for the natural growth and contraction that occurs with temperature level variations.

Upkeep Practices for Longevity


Proper upkeep extends the lifespan of UPVC door glass setups while maintaining their appearance and efficiency characteristics. Luckily, UPVC systems require considerably less upkeep than wooden or metal options.

Routine cleansing with mild cleaning agent and warm water removes collected dirt and ecological residues that can dull appearance with time. Preventing abrasive cleaners and cleaning tools avoids scratching of both glass surface areas and UPVC frames. Checking weather condition seals each year helps recognize wear and tear early, permitting prompt replacement before water seepage triggers more considerable problems.

Lubricating hinges and moving hardware with suitable products preserves smooth operation and avoids mechanical wear. Inspecting the operation of locks and latches ensures continued security functionality. Resolving any small problems promptly prevents escalation into more substantial problems that may need total hardware replacement.

Regularly Asked Questions


Do I need preparing permission for UPVC door glass setup?

In many cases, setting up glass in an existing UPVC door or changing a strong panel with a glazed one falls under permitted development rights and does not require official preparation authorization. However, residential or commercial properties in preservation locations, noted structures, or those based on particular limiting covenants might require approval before alterations. Consulting with regional preparation authorities or an expert installer clarifies requirements particular to your circumstance.

How long does professional installation take?

Requirement UPVC door glass replacement generally requires in between two and four hours of labour, depending on frame condition and gain access to complexity. Full door replacements with new frames normally inhabit many of a working day.factors such as customized sizes, specialised glass requirements, or structural modifications extend completion timelines accordingly.

Can existing UPVC doors be retrofitted with glass panels?

Numerous UPVC doors developed for solid building can accommodate glass panel installation through modification of the door leaf. This procedure includes cutting an opening in the UPVC panel and installing a glazed system within a new frame structure. However, not all door designs permit modification, and structural integrity should be thoroughly evaluated before proceeding. Consulting with knowledgeable installers identifies expediency for particular door setups.

What security functions should I think about for UPVC door glass?

Multi-point locking systems, enhanced glass alternatives, and additional hardware such as security chains or deadbolts boost the security of UPVC door setups. Laminated glass supplies remarkable resistance to required entry compared to basic toughened glass. Setting up a door audience or wise doorbell allows recognition of visitors before granting access. Professional installers can suggest appropriate security configurations based on specific requirements and budget plan restrictions.

How energy effective is UPVC door glass compared to solid doors?

Modern double-glazed UPVC door setups attain U-values between 1.0 and 1.8 W/m ² K, significantly surpassing solid wood doors, which normally achieve U-values around 3.0 W/m TWO K or higher. This efficiency equates to measurably lower energy intake for heating & cooling. The specific performance depends on glass requirements, frame quality, and setup precision.
